Overview
HAI being the major aviation
repair and manufacturing center in Greece, utilizes advanced
technology and equipment of utmost precision in carrying out
its work and implementing customer contracts.
The Physical Science
Laboratory commenced its operations in parallel with HAI’s
production activities and through all these years has been
demonstrating exceptional competence in providing accurate,
precise and safe performance of tests and analyses in support
of HAI production operations and subcontractor evaluation
processes as well as a wide range of customers (including
armed forces, industry, research centers, public
organizations, technical assistance, aviation and maritime
companies) in accordance with approved references and
documentation.

Its highly qualified technicians perform more
than 5000 tests and analyses per year utilizing
state-of-the-art prototype equipment which are calibrated and
serviced by HAI PME Laboratory an entity which uses standards
traceable to the National Standards. The PSL area covers 600
sq.m. and consists of two separate Laboratories, the Chemical
Laboratory and the Metal Laboratory each performing the
following functions :

All tests are carried out in a
protected environment against extreme conditions such as heat,
dust, humidity and noise and all necessary equipment and
energy sources for the performance of the tests are available.
In addition, devices monitoring environmental conditions are
available, when it is so required for the performance of
tests.
The Laboratory’s Quality System
follows the requirements of the international standard
EN-45001 and is audited periodically by such internatiional
organizations and companies as Bureau Veritas International,
Aerospatiale, Boeing, Dasa, General Electric, NAMSA, etc.
The PSL participates successfully
in interlaboratory testing programs arranged by Joap TSC,
Aerospatiale, Snecma and General Electric, concerning Hardness
Testing, Tensile Testing. Aluminum Alloys Spectrometric
Analysis, Thermal Spray Metallographic Analysis and
Spectrometric Oil Analysis.
